图书介绍

Visual Basic 2008程序设计:第7版PDF|Epub|txt|kindle电子书版本网盘下载

Visual Basic 2008程序设计:第7版
  • (美)施奈德(Schneider,D)著 著
  • 出版社: 北京:清华大学出版社
  • ISBN:9787302191001
  • 出版时间:2009
  • 标注页数:578页
  • 文件大小:82MB
  • 文件页数:597页
  • 主题词:BASIC语言-程序设计-高等学校-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

Visual Basic 2008程序设计:第7版P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 计算机与问题求解概述1

1.1 计算机简介1

1.2 Windows、文件夹与文件3

1.2.1 Windows及其小窗口3

1.2.2 鼠标的动作3

1.2.3 文件与文件夹4

1.3 程序开发周期6

1.3.1 在计算机上执行任务6

1.3.2 程序规划6

1.4 编程工具7

1.4.1 流程图8

1.4.2 伪代码9

1.4.3 层次图9

1.4.4 确定纽约市给定编号街道的方向的算法10

1.4.5 班级平均成绩算法11

1.4.6 补充说明11

第2章 Visual Basic、控件与事件14

2.1 Visual Basic 2008概述14

2.1.1 为什么使用Windows和Visual Basic14

2.1.2 如何开发Visual Basic程序15

2.1.3 Visual Basic的不同版本16

2.2 Visual Basic控件16

2.2.1 开始一个新的Visual Basic程序16

2.2.2 文本框演练19

2.2.3 按钮演练23

2.2.4 标签演练24

2.2.5 列表框演练24

2.2.6 Name属性25

2.2.7 帮助演练26

2.2.8 字体26

2.2.9 自动隐藏27

2.2.10 放置和排列控件27

2.2.11 设置制表符顺序29

2.2.12 补充说明29

思考题2.230

练习题2.230

思考题2.2的解答33

2.3 Visual Basic事件33

2.3.1 事件过程演练35

2.3.2 表单的属性和事件过程38

2.3.3 事件过程头38

2.3.4 上下文感知帮助38

2.3.5 文本文件38

2.3.6 查看控件的所有事件过程39

2.3.7 打开一个程序40

2.3.8 补充说明41

思考题2.342

练习题2.342

思考题2.3的解答47

2.4 本章小结47

第3章 变量、输入与输出48

3.1 数字48

3.1.1 算术运算48

3.1.2 变量49

3.1.3 增加变量的值52

3.1.4 内置函数:Math.Sqrt、Int和Math.Round52

3.1.5 Integer数据类型53

3.1.6 声明多个变量54

3.1.7 括号54

3.1.8 三种错误类型54

3.1.9 Error List窗口55

3.1.10 补充说明55

思考题3.156

练习题3.157

思考题3.1的解答62

3.2 字符串63

3.2.1 变量与字符串63

3.2.2 Option Explicit与Option Strict64

3.2.3 使用文本框输入和输出65

3.2.4 自动更正66

3.2.5 连接66

3.2.6 字符串属性和方法:Length属性及ToUpper、ToLower、Trim、IndexOf和Substring方法67

3.2.7 空字符串70

3.2.8 字符串的初始值70

3.2.9 扩增与受限70

3.2.10 内部注释71

3.2.11 续行字符72

3.2.12 变量的作用范围72

3.2.13 补充说明73

思考题3.274

练习题3.274

思考题3.2的解答79

3.3 输入和输出80

3.3.1 使用格式函数按格式化输出80

3.3.2 用区域格式化输出80

3.3.3 从文件读取数据82

3.3.4 使用输入对话框输入信息86

3.3.5 使用消息对话框输出信息88

3.3.6 使用掩码文本框输入信息88

3.3.7 补充说明90

思考题3.390

练习题3.391

思考题3.3的解答99

3.4 本章小结99

3.5 程序设计项目100

第4章 判断103

4.1 关系运算符和逻辑运算符103

4.1.1 ANSI值103

4.1.2 关系运算符104

4.1.3 逻辑运算符106

4.1.4 Boolean数据类型107

4.1.5 补充说明107

思考题4.1108

练习题4.1108

思考题4.1的解答110

4.2 If代码块110

4.2.1 If代码块110

4.2.2 ElseIf子句114

4.2.3 补充说明116

思考题4.2117

练习题4.2117

思考题4.2的解答126

4.3 Select Case代码块126

4.3.1 补充说明133

思考题4.3134

练习题4.3134

思考题4.3的解答142

4.5 本章小结142

4.6 程序设计项目143

第5章 一般过程145

5.1 Sub过程,第1部分145

5.1.1 将变量和表达式用作参数150

5.1.2 Sub过程调用其他Sub过程153

5.1.3 补充说明154

思考题5.1154

练习题5.1155

思考题5.1的解答168

5.2 Sub过程,第2部分168

5.2.1 按值传递168

5.2.2 按引用传递169

5.2.3 变量的生命周期与作用范围172

5.2.4 调试173

思考题5.2174

练习题5.2174

思考题5.2的解答182

5.3 Function过程183

5.3.1 带有多个参数的自定义函数185

5.3.2 不带参数的自定义函数189

5.3.3 自定义布尔值函数189

5.3.4 比较Function过程与Sub过程190

5.3.5 命名常量190

思考题5.3191

练习题5.3192

思考题5.3的解答197

5.4 模块化设计197

5.4.1 自顶向下设计197

5.4.2 结构化程序设计199

5.4.3 结构化程序设计的优点199

5.4.4 面向对象程序设计201

5.4.5 相关引语201

5.5 实例分析:周工资单201

5.5.1 设计周工资单程序203

5.5.2 工资单事件的伪代码203

5.5.3 编写周工资单程序204

5.5.4 程序和用户界面204

5.5.5 补充说明209

5.6 本章小结209

5.7 程序设计项目210

第6章 循环213

6.1 Do循环213

6.1.1 补充说明217

思考题6.1218

练习题6.1218

思考题6.1的解答224

6.2 使用Do循环处理数据列表224

6.2.1 Peek方法225

6.2.2 计数器和累加器227

6.2.3 标记228

6.2.4 嵌套循环230

6.2.5 补充说明231

思考题6.2231

练习题6.2232

思考题6.2的解答239

6.3 For…Next循环239

6.3.1 嵌套For…Next循环244

6.3.2 补充说明245

思考题6.3245

练习题6.3245

思考题6.3的解答252

6.4 实例分析:分析贷款252

6.4.1 设计分析贷款程序252

6.4.2 用户界面253

6.4.3 分析贷款程序的伪代码255

6.4.4 编写分析贷款程序256

6.4.5 补充说明260

6.5 本章小结260

6.6 程序设计项目261

第7章 数组266

7.1 创建和访问数组266

7.1.1 声明数组变量267

7.1.2 Load事件过程269

7.1.3 GetUpperBound方法270

7.1.4 ReDim语句270

7.1.5 将数组用作频率表272

7.1.6 数值的赋值语句273

7.1.7 自定义数组值的函数274

7.1.8 补充说明275

思考题7.1275

练习题7.1275

思考题7.1的解答283

7.2 使用数组283

7.2.1 有序数组283

7.2.2 使用数组中的部分数据285

7.2.3 合并两个有序数组286

7.2.4 将数组传递给过程288

7.2.5 补充说明291

思考题7.2292

练习题7.2292

思考题7.2的解答297

7.3 一些其他类型的数组298

7.3.1 控件数组298

7.3.2 结构300

7.3.3 显示和比较结构值305

思考题7.3305

练习题7.3305

思考题7.3的解答312

7.4 排序和查找313

7.4.1 冒泡排序314

7.4.2 希尔排序318

7.4.3 查找321

7.4.4 补充说明326

思考题7.4326

练习题7.4327

思考题7.4的解答332

7.5 二维数组332

7.5.1 补充说明339

思考题7.5339

练习题7.5339

思考题7.5的解答346

7.6 实例分析:一台成熟的收银机347

7.6.1 程序设计347

7.6.2 用户界面347

7.6.3 数据结构349

7.6.4 程序编码349

7.7 本章小结356

7.8 程序设计项目357

第8章 顺序文件363

8.1 顺序文件概述363

8.1.1 创建顺序文件363

8.1.2 向顺序文件添加条目365

8.1.3 结构化的异常处理369

8.1.4 补充说明373

思考题8.1373

练习题8.1373

思考题8.1的解答379

8.2 使用顺序文件381

8.2.1 对顺序文件进行排序381

8.2.2 CSV格式383

8.2.3 合并顺序文件385

8.2.4 控制改变处理387

8.2.5 补充说明389

思考题8.2389

练习题8.2390

思考题8.2的解答392

8.3 实例分析:记录支票和存款392

8.3.1 程序设计392

8.3.2 用户界面393

8.3.3 程序编码395

8.4 本章小结403

8.5 程序设计项目404

第9章 其他控件与对象409

9.1 列表框、组合框和文件打开控件409

9.1.1 列表框控件409

9.1.2 在设计时填充列表框411

9.1.3 使用数组来填充列表框412

9.1.4 组合框控件412

9.1.5 OpenFileDialog控件414

思考题9.1416

练习题9.1416

思考题9.1的解答419

9.2 七种基本的控件419

9.2.1 分组框控件419

9.2.2 复选框控件419

9.2.3 单选钮控件421

9.2.4 定时器控件422

9.2.5 图片框控件423

9.2.6 水平滚动条和垂直滚动条控件424

思考题9.2426

练习题9.2426

思考题9.2的解答429

9.3 四种其他对象429

9.3.1 Clipboard对象429

9.3.2 Random类430

9.3.3 MenuStrip控件430

9.3.4 多表单433

思考题9.3436

练习题9.3437

思考题9.3的解答439

9.4 图形439

9.4.1 图形对象439

9.4.2 线、矩形、圆和扇形440

9.4.3 饼图442

9.4.4 条形图443

9.4.5 动画444

9.4.6 补充说明445

思考题9.4446

练习题9.4446

思考题9.4的解答448

9.5 本章小结449

9.6 程序设计项目449

第10章 数据库管理454

10.1 数据库简介454

10.1.1 Database Explorer455

10.1.2 使用数据表访问数据库457

10.1.3 把列表框绑定到数据表461

10.1.4 把已有数据库导入程序462

思考题10.1463

练习题10.1463

思考题10.1的解答466

10.2 关系数据库和SQL467

10.2.1 主键和外键467

10.2.2 SQL468

10.2.3 四种SQL请求(查询)468

10.2.4 DataGridView控件471

10.2.5 改变数据库的内容474

10.2.6 使用SQL实现计算列476

10.2.7 补充说明477

思考题10.2477

练习题10.2478

思考题10.2的解答483

10.3 本章小结483

10.4 程序设计项目483

第11章 面向对象程序设计486

11.1 类和对象486

11.1.1 对象构造器493

思考题11.1496

练习题11.1497

思考题11.1的解答502

11.2 对象数组、事件与包含502

11.2.1 对象数组502

11.2.2 事件505

11.2.3 包含508

思考题11.2512

练习题11.2512

思考题11.2的解答514

11.3 继承515

11.3.1 多态与重载520

11.3.2 抽象属性、方法和类525

11.3.3 补充说明529

思考题11.3529

练习题11.3530

思考题11.3的解答535

11.4 本章小结535

11.5 程序设计项目536

附录A ANSI值538

附录B 如何541

附录C 从Visual Basic 6.0转换到Visual Basic 2008558

附录D Visual Basic调试工具564

附录E 计算发展史573

热门推荐